Polishing definition
Polishing means a procedure limited to the removal of Plaque and extrinsic stain from exposed natural and restored tooth sur- faces that utilizes an appropriate rotary instrument with rubber cup or brush and polishing agent. A Licensee or dental assistant shall not represent that this procedure alone constitutes an oral Prophylaxis.
